Welcome to the Department of Sociology!

The Sociology Program at MU prepares you to examine society at every level — from world cultures to face-to-face social interaction. You will learn to conduct research and analyze data, communicate skillfully, practice critical thinking and gain a global perspective. An undergraduate major in sociology provides an excellent foundation for graduate study in a wide range of fields including law, business, social work, medicine, public health, public administration and of course, sociology.

Sociology majors explore many global and local social problems including, but not limited to: urbanization, environmental sustainability, healthcare reform, violent conflicts, and unequal access to educational opportunities. Above all sociology majors study theory and research methods designed to help us understand and bring about social change. As a senior, your studies culminate in an internship at an approved local community organization, or a supervised research project. There is an honor society available to sociology majors. Our sociology club includes any interested students and supports campus events, such as visiting speakers.
